Alliance Recovery Corporation (ARVY) Research
Alliance Recovery Corporation is an emerging company that specializes in pioneering technologies designed to transform various waste materials, including industrial refuse, into valuable resources. Its core mission involves upcycling these waste streams into marketable outputs such as fuel oil, gases, and other commodities. Specifically, the company's primary objective is to convert industrial and other waste into electrical energy, which it intends to sell to industrial clients or supply to local power grids. Additionally, Alliance Recovery aims to generate and market valuable co-products, including carbon black, reclaimed steel, and thermal energy in the form of steam or hot water. Founded in 2001 and head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ware, the company originally operated under the name American Resource Recovery Group, Ltd., before rebranding as Alliance Recovery Corporation in 2002.
